When homeowners in Ventura County take on a renovation project, the last thing they expect is to uncover a hidden pest problem—or worse, accidentally invite new pests inside. Whether you’re opening up walls, replacing flooring, or expanding your home, construction activity can disrupt existing pest habitats and create fresh entry points. Without the right preventive steps, a dream remodel can quickly turn into a pest control headache.

Why Renovation Work Attracts Pests

Renovations often involve disturbing the structural “status quo” of a home. Walls are opened, soil is moved, foundations are exposed, and temporary gaps or openings are left unsealed. To pests, these disruptions can look like invitations:

  • Unsealed wall cavities become instant access points for ants, cockroaches, and rodents.
  • Exposed soil and foundation attract subterranean termites, which thrive in Ventura County’s mild, moisture-rich climate.
  • Debris piles and wood scraps provide temporary nesting grounds for spiders, rodents, and other opportunistic pests.
  • Changes in moisture levels, such as plumbing work or new landscaping, can draw termites and ants looking for hydration.

In short, construction creates opportunities. And Southern California’s year-round pest activity means there’s almost always something waiting to take advantage.

Common Culprits During Home Renovations

While almost any pest can exploit a renovation, some are especially notorious in Southern California homes:

Termites

Subterranean and drywood termites are among the biggest threats. Opening up walls can reveal hidden galleries, frass (termite droppings), or damaged studs. Termites often go unnoticed for years, so renovations frequently become the moment homeowners discover extensive damage.

Ants

Odorous house ants and Argentine ants are common in Ventura County. They enter through small cracks left during remodeling, often in search of water sources disturbed by plumbing work.

Rodents

When contractors open attics, crawl spaces, or exterior walls, rodents may seize the chance to move indoors. Construction noise can also push existing rodent populations to relocate within the structure.

Cockroaches

Cockroaches thrive in warm, dark spaces like newly opened wall voids and utility chases. If old pipes or wiring are replaced, roaches can follow the gaps left behind.

Spiders

Although spiders are often a secondary problem, they’re drawn to renovation sites because the other pests they feed on are plentiful. Webs often appear around construction debris or temporary openings.

How Renovations Can Uncover Hidden Infestations

In many cases, homeowners don’t have a new pest problem—they finally see an old one. Renovation work is one of the most common times termite infestations are discovered in Ventura County. When drywall or baseboards are removed, homeowners may find:

  • Hollowed-out wood beams
  • Termite frass along baseboards or window sills
  • Mud tubes running up foundation walls
  • Old damage that’s been painted over or concealed

Similarly, tearing out kitchen cabinets or bathroom flooring can expose long-hidden cockroach harborage zones or rodent nesting materials. What was previously invisible suddenly becomes obvious.
